NN4 0JA is a sought-after residential area on Wootton Hall Park, 0.7km from Blacky More in Northampton. Administratively it sits within East Hunsbury and Shelfleys ward and the South Northamptonshire constituency.
One of the more sought-after postcodes in NN4, NN4 0JA offers a culturally diverse area with a strong community identity. During the day, public administration and security with mainly white workforces. The community skews young professional (average age 34) — expect a mix of renters, sharers, and first-time buyers. 73%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address. Employment levels are high (49% in full-time work) — a well-connected, economically active community.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 24 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£311k.
